Oly unveil Amadu Sulley as Head Coach

Accra Great Olympics on Monday unveiled Coach Amadu Sulley as new Head Coach and head of the club’s technical team at a short ceremony held at the club’s secretariat.
He was tasked to steer the club’s return to Premier League status, a task he admitted was huge but possible with the support of all.
In the presence of the new Chief Executive of the club, Mr Kudjoe Fianoo, and other notable officials, he initialed the two-year contract to accept the responsibility to return the club to its glory past.
Coach Sulley is credited to the qualification of Heart of Lions to the premiership last two seasons.
He holds a CAF License B certificate.
He left to join Okwahu United in another qualification bid last season but lost that plot to Hohoe United who placed first.
According to Mr Kudjoe Fianoo, the first charge to the coach would be to instill discipline in the players but at the same time create a healthy environment between him and the players.
The General Manager of the club, Mr Eric Alagidede, told the coach that they had full confidence in him and was ready to support for the greater good of the club.
Meanwhile, training for the new season started yesterday at the McDan Park for both old and new players for the upcoming season.
